CULTURE NEWS

  • The Diocese of Laredo is set to mark its 25th anniversary with a commemorative Mass at 10 a.m. at Sames Auto Arena on Saturday, Aug. 9, expecting about 9,000 attendees + volunteer support for a safely distributed Eucharist. Father Joe Cadena said the celebration follows a year of events including youth gatherings and Eucharistic processions in Laredo and Eagle Pass, and a special pre-service show will begin at 9 a.m. on air + online.  KGNS News

GOVERNMENT NEWS

  • Webb County officials said the new Sheriff's Office administrative building on Farragut Street is expected to open by October after years of planning, funding hurdles, and construction delays. The county spent over $10 million on renovations plus $1 million for the Emergency Operations Center as repairs addressed issues like roof leaks and delayed equipment.  KGNS News
